1. Is it toxic?Narcissus is a poisonous plant, and the whole plant is poisonous, so be careful during the cultivation period and try not to touch it casually. Its bulbs, flowers and sap are all poisonous, but its fragrance is not, so it can be safely controlled as long as you pay attention. In addition, if there are children at home, they must be closely supervised to prevent accidental ingestion, and do not let children touch the juice of the plant. 2. Can it be placed in the bedroom?You can place daffodils in the bedroom, but if the living room has the conditions, it is recommended that you grow them in the living room. Although it is highly ornamental, it also has a strong fragrance. Placing it in the bedroom will make people sleep poorly. In addition, the plants will absorb oxygen in the room at night, which can easily affect people's sleep. 3. NotesAlthough it is a poisonous plant and absorbs oxygen at night, it also has a certain purifying effect. It is best to place it in the living room or balcony. |
